  • Publication number: 20220239909
    Abstract: A method for operating a two-dimensional (2D) separable interpolation filter for coding a video, wherein the two-dimensional separable interpolation filter comprises a first and a second one-dimensional (1D) interpolation filter and a temporal buffer of a predetermined buffer size, wherein the method comprises: obtaining filter coefficients for the first one-dimensional interpolation filter of the two-dimensional interpolation filter; comparing a sum of positive filter coefficients of the obtained filter coefficients with a threshold; and upon determining that the sum of positive filter coefficients is larger than the threshold, amending one or more of the filter coefficients to obtain amended filter coefficients, wherein the one or more filter coefficients are amended such that a sum of positive filter coefficients of the amended filter coefficients is not larger than the threshold; applying the amended filter coefficients to samples of the video to obtain a value of a fractional sample position of the video

  • Publication number: 20220234970
    Abstract: Disclosed is a preparation method for triphenylchloromethane, comprising the following steps: adding hydrochloric acid or a mixture of hydrochloric acid and Lewis acid to a mixture of triphenylmethanol and an organic solvent; stirring for reaction; removing the water layer after the completion of reaction to obtain an organic solution containing triphenylchloromethane. In the method, the conversion rate of triphenylmethanol is almost quantitative to be above 99%, and the content of triphenylchloromethane in the product obtained is above 99%. The operation is simple, and no waste gas is generated. Therefore, the method is environmentally friendly and suitable for industrialized production and can achieve better economic benefits.

  • Publication number: 20220234929
    Abstract: The present invention relates to a method for sludge safe disposal and resource recovery through sludge liquefaction and stratification. The method is to completely liquefy the organic matters in the sludge into soluble organic matters through a thermal-alkaline synergistic treatment. After the treatment, the sludge is stratified, and an anaerobic digestion is performed on a high-concentration soluble liquid of an upper layer to convert organic carbon, nitrogen and phosphorus into biogas, ammonia nitrogen and phosphate, a crude protein recovery is performed on a sludge protein of a middle layer, and a dewatering and a landfill on a sludge inorganic solid of a lower layer.

  • Publication number: 20220235013
    Abstract: The present invention describes 2-methyl-quinazoline compounds of general formula (I), methods of preparing said compounds, intermediate compounds useful for preparing said compounds, pharmaceutical compositions and combinations comprising said compounds, and the use of said compounds for manufacturing pharmaceutical compositions. The 2-methyl substituted quinazoline compounds of general formula (I) effectively and selectively inhibit the Ras-Sos interaction without significantly targeting the EGFR receptor. They are therefore useful for the treatment or prophylaxis of diseases, in particular of hyperproliferative disorders, such as cancer as a sole agent or in combination with other active ingredients.
